A Morgantown man has been sentenced to prison for his role in a significant methamphetamine trafficking operation in West Virginia. Steven Reger, 47, was handed a five-year and three-month prison sentence, to be followed by three years of supervised release, for aiding and abetting the distribution of 50 grams or more of methamphetamine.
According to court documents and statements made in court, on March 23, 2021, Reger sold approximately 428.1 grams of methamphetamine to a confidential informant near a garage in Parkersburg. Reger admitted to selling the methamphetamine to the informant and receiving $5,000 as well as $10,000 from prior drug deals from the informant.
The investigation into Reger’s activities was led by the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) and the Parkersburg Drug and Violent Crime Task Force. United States Attorney Will Thompson commended the investigative work of these agencies in bringing Reger to justice.
Chief United States District Judge Thomas E. Johnston imposed the sentence in the case. Assistant United States Attorneys Joshua Hanks and Negar M. Kordestani prosecuted the case.
